Tips for gathering evidence to demonstrate your skills

The important thing to remember when gathering evidence is that the more evidence the better - that is, the more evidence you gather to demonstrate your skills, the more confident an assessor can be that you have learned the skills not just at one point in time, but are continuing to apply and develop those skills (as opposed to just learning for the test!). Furthermore, one piece of evidence that you collect will not usualy demonstrate all the required criteria for a unit of competency, whereas multiple overlapping pieces of evidence will usually do the trick!

MEASTR0002 - Modify and repair aircraft composite materials structures and components

What evidence can you provide to prove your understanding of each of the following citeria?

Plan repair or modification

  1. Assess extent of damage using visual and tap test methods to assist in determining repair procedure
  2. Support structure and prepare it in accordance with maintenance manual to ensure personnel safety and avoidance of damage
  3. Identify suitable modification or repair scheme in accordance with structural repair manual and relevant data
  4. Obtain specialist or supervisory advice to establish an approved repair scheme where a standard repair scheme cannot be identified, or damage criteria are out of limits
  5. Organise all required materials and equipment in readiness for repair or modification

Prepare components for hot bonding

  1. Prepare components in accordance with process specification while observing all relevant work health and safety (WHS) requirements, including the use of material safety data sheets (MSDSs) and items of personal protective equipment (PPE)
  2. Check bagging to ensure vacuum seal is correct
  3. Place temperature probes to provide accurate measurement
  4. Check equipment for serviceability to ensure safety in application
  5. Lay heat blanket on component or structure to be repaired or modified, ensuring even temperature distribution

Repair or modify components using hot bond

  1. Operate hot bonding equipment in accordance with equipment manufacturer’s procedures to achieve the void-free lamination
  2. Monitor vacuum and temperature recordings, including checking hot and cold spots on trailing and leading temperature probes, to ensure specifications are met
  3. Monitor curing cycle and operating cycle data recording in accordance with specified procedures to ensure specifications are met
  4. Seal, pot or fill blemishes as required and in accordance with process specification
  5. Prepare component assemblies, including test pieces, that need further or special treatment for the required processes
  6. Complete and process required maintenance documentation relating to hot bond repair or modification in accordance with standard enterprise procedures
  7. Tag, seal and pack completed assemblies in accordance with specified procedures
  8. Handle and store composite materials used in accordance with industry standards

Repair or modify components using cold cure

  1. Check lay-up of materials to confirm that components meet specifications while observing all relevant WHS requirements, including the use of MSDSs and items of PPE
  2. Regularly monitor curing cycle to ensure specifications are met
  3. Check components for blemishes or delamination in accordance with quality procedures
  4. Prepare component assemblies requiring further or special treatment for the required processes
  5. Complete and process required maintenance documentation in accordance with standard enterprise procedures
  6. Tag, seal or pack completed assemblies in accordance with specific procedures
  7. Handle and store composite materials used in accordance with industry standards
